Default Screws for the stick shift boot

I have a 92 f150 with 4.9 I6 and 4 speed standard trans - 2 years new to me. The last owner did not screw the boot down for the transmission. It needs a screw in each corner of the boot, 4 in total. Does anyone know the specs of those 4 screws? TIA

They are called sheet metal screws and if you go to any auto supply store you can pick the size you want. They usually have a phillips head type screw.about 3/4 inch in length.
